Another complication that we've discussed that does not come into things like ranking baseball players is some fuzziness about what makes someone a "one hit."

If an artist has a pretty decent and critically successful career in another genre or another country, and manages to make one pop song that gets onto the American Billboard Top 100, then they meet the technical definition. But they don't feel as pure to me as some guy who basically had one pop song that took off and never did anything else of note in another country or another genre.

I'm not sure at all how to account for that, but it does add to some sense of the difficulty in trying to nail this down.
